Either way, Sotomayor’s reticence, if not her nomination, has disappointed legal thinkers on the left. The hearings “did serious damage to the cause of progressive thought in constitutional law,” said Geoffrey R. Stone, a University of Chicago Law School professor who was dean there when Obama joined its faculty. Doug Kendall, president of the Constitutional Accountability Center, a liberal think tank, called them “a totally missed opportunity. . . . The progressive legal project hit rock bottom [last] week.”
